MHEDA Mourns the Loss of Jack D. Patten, Sr.

In Loving Memory

Jack D. Patten, Sr. – June 20, 1931 – November 18, 2024 (93 years)

Jack founded Materials Handling Equipment Company (MHECO) in 1952 and led it until 2002. MHECO was a leading “full line” material handling distributor, offering everything from casters and hand trucks to forklifts and automated systems. Jack was President of the MHEDA Board of Directors in 1963, one of the youngest to serve the industry in this role.

Jack was married to Dolores for 72 years. His community service included as Potentate of the El Jebel Shrine in Denver. He loved riding motorcycles (“bikes”) and he and Dolores rode them thousands of miles together. A memorial service will be held in May, 2025. Donations can be made to Shriners Hospital for Children.
